BMW pulled the plug. 🔌

As of July 1st, 2021, BMW no longer allows authentication to their ConnectedDrive servers, effectively eliminating all apps (like this one) from sending remote requests. This coincides with a major update/overhaul of their official app, which apparently includes a subscription fee as one of its new "features".

It's with a heavy heart that I therefore have to pull the plug on my beloved bmwcd. I suspect some of the other maintainers of related projects are going to be faced with the same decision. It was fun while it lasted, I just wish I could have realized the finished product before it was terminated.

Maybe the community will be able to reverse-engineer this new API... but for now it seems BMW is strong-arming us into paying for these features, and restricting them to their implementation.
